Egypt Reiterates Support for Syria Amidst Latakia Clashes Leading to Civilian Deaths

Egypt has expressed deep concern over the recent violent clashes in Latakia, Syria, leading to hundreds of civilian casualties. In a statement, Egypt emphasized its support for Syrian state institutions and condemned any actions threatening Syria’s security. President Ahmed Al Sharaa vowed to hold accountable those responsible for the violence, asserting the need for a comprehensive political process that includes all Syrian factions.

On March 8, 2025, Egypt conveyed its grave concerns regarding the violent clashes in Latakia Governorate, Syria, which led to significant civilian casualties. An official statement highlighted Egypt’s solid support for Syria’s national institutions and the imperative for maintaining stability amidst considerable security challenges.

Egypt firmly rejected any actions that might threaten the security and safety of the Syrian population, emphasizing the necessity of addressing violence comprehensively. The statement stressed that safeguarding Syrian national security must be a priority during this critical transitional phase.

Additionally, Egypt reiterated the essential need to establish a robust transitional political process that encourages the participation of all segments of the Syrian citizenry, ensuring that the rights of all sects are respected.

Clashes between Syrian government forces and pro-Assad factions erupted in Latakia starting March 6, resulting in the tragic death of 333 civilians, according to the Syrian Observatory for Human Rights. To mitigate further violence, a curfew was imposed in the regions of Latakia, Homs, and Tartus.

In response to these incidents, Syrian President Ahmed Al Sharaa condemned the actions of pro-Assad forces, pledging to hold them accountable. He described their attacks as heinous acts against all Syrians, urging them to disarm and surrender before facing dire consequences.

Furthermore, sources reported that remnants of the former regime targeted the National Hospital in Latakia, with General Security Forces actively countering this aggression. The Ministry of Defense confirmed that government forces successfully thwarted an assault on the naval command in Latakia, restoring stability in the area.
